Variety description

10 August 2026

The plant reaches a height of 1.5–3 meters. It has thick leathery heart-shaped leaves with wavy edges and a "bumpy" texture, which have a reddish hue when unfurling and later become dark green. The branches have a characteristic zigzag shape, which causes the leaves to be arranged in a distinct two-row pattern.

Flowering is abundant, occurring in April–May before the leaves appear. Fuchsia-pink flowers bloom directly on the branches. The variety has winter hardiness down to -20°C, is drought-tolerant after rooting, and is also resistant to air pollution and calcareous soils.

Plant breeders' rights

The right is granted for a limited term: propagation of the variety requires a license from the rights holder.

European Union № 20061428
Terminated
  1. Application filed 7 June 2006
  2. Registered 20 April 2009
  3. Entry closed 15 March 2013
